STATEMENT ON THE PRESIDENCY OF THE OCEANIA KUNG FU WUSHU FEDERATION

This formal Statement is made to remove any doubt about the Presidency of the Oceania Kung Fu Wushu Federation (OKWF).

With great regret, OKWF announced the death of President Mr Walt Missingham, who had done so much for the federation and its members.

With Mr Missingham’s death, the Board of OKWF consisted of only two members.

The OKWF Constitution requires a minimum of 3 Directors on its Board (Clause 11.1.1), and the Board met as a matter of urgency, on 2 May 2025, to ensure consistency with this requirement.

A third Director was appointed, under Clauses 11.5.1(a) and 11.5.4 of the Constitution. These Clauses, with Clause 11.1.1, gave the Board little option in how to ensure it is operating in accord with the Constitution.

Mr Shao Zhao Ming was appointed as the third Director. OKWF notes that this was in accord with the strong recommendation of Mr Missingham.

The Board now consisted of three Directors, which required a new President. Mr Shao was the only one of the three Directors who was nominated for the position of President, and thus was the only Candidate eligible for election. Mr Shao accepted his nomination, and was duly elected as our new President.

As OKWF is based in Australia, the Australian Securities and Investments Commission was duly advised of the composition of the new Board.
